43 /*  The gimplification pass converts the language-dependent trees
44     (ld-trees) emitted by the parser into language-independent trees
45     (li-trees) that are the target of SSA analysis and transformations.
46 
47     Language-independent trees are based on the SIMPLE intermediate
48     representation used in the McCAT compiler framework:
49 
50     "Designing the McCAT Compiler Based on a Family of Structured
51     Intermediate Representations,"
52     L. Hendren, C. Donawa, M. Emami, G. Gao, Justiani, and B. Sridharan,
53     Proceedings of the 5th International Workshop on Languages and
54     Compilers for Parallel Computing, no. 757 in Lecture Notes in
55     Computer Science, New Haven, Connecticut, pp. 406-420,
56     Springer-Verlag, August 3-5, 1992.
57 
58     http://www-acaps.cs.mcgill.ca/info/McCAT/McCAT.html
59 
60     Basically, we walk down gimplifying the nodes that we encounter.  As we
61     walk back up, we check that they fit our constraints, and copy them
62     into temporaries if not.  */

120 /* Genericize a scope by creating a new BIND_EXPR.
121    BLOCK is either a BLOCK representing the scope or a chain of _DECLs.
122      In the latter case, we need to create a new BLOCK and add it to the
123      BLOCK_SUBBLOCKS of the enclosing block.
124    BODY is a chain of C _STMT nodes for the contents of the scope, to be
125      genericized.  */
126 
127 tree
128 c_build_bind_expr (location_t loc, tree block, tree body)
129 {
130   tree decls, bind;
131 
132   if (block == NULL_TREE)
133     decls = NULL_TREE;
134   else if (TREE_CODE (block) == BLOCK)
135     decls = BLOCK_VARS (block);
136   else
137     {
138       decls = block;
139       if (DECL_ARTIFICIAL (decls))
140 	block = NULL_TREE;
141       else
142 	{
143 	  block = make_node (BLOCK);
144 	  BLOCK_VARS (block) = decls;
145 	  add_block_to_enclosing (block);
146 	}
147     }
148 
149   if (!body)
150     body = build_empty_stmt (loc);
151   if (decls || block)
152     {
153       bind = build3 (BIND_EXPR, void_type_node, decls, body, block);
154       TREE_SIDE_EFFECTS (bind) = 1;
155       SET_EXPR_LOCATION (bind, loc);
156     }
157   else
158     bind = body;
159 
160   return bind;
161 }

165 /* Do C-specific gimplification on *EXPR_P.  PRE_P and POST_P are as in
166    gimplify_expr.  */
167 
168 int
169 c_gimplify_expr (tree *expr_p, gimple_seq *pre_p ATTRIBUTE_UNUSED,
170 		 gimple_seq *post_p ATTRIBUTE_UNUSED)
171 {
172   enum tree_code code = TREE_CODE (*expr_p);
173 
174   switch (code)
175     {
176     case DECL_EXPR:
177       /* This is handled mostly by gimplify.c, but we have to deal with
178 	 not warning about int x = x; as it is a GCC extension to turn off
179 	 this warning but only if warn_init_self is zero.  */
180       if (TREE_CODE (DECL_EXPR_DECL (*expr_p)) == VAR_DECL
181 	  && !DECL_EXTERNAL (DECL_EXPR_DECL (*expr_p))
182 	  && !TREE_STATIC (DECL_EXPR_DECL (*expr_p))
183 	  && (DECL_INITIAL (DECL_EXPR_DECL (*expr_p)) == DECL_EXPR_DECL (*expr_p))
184 	  && !warn_init_self)
185 	TREE_NO_WARNING (DECL_EXPR_DECL (*expr_p)) = 1;
186       break;
187 
188     case PREINCREMENT_EXPR:
189     case PREDECREMENT_EXPR:
190     case POSTINCREMENT_EXPR:
191     case POSTDECREMENT_EXPR:
192       {
193 	tree type = TREE_TYPE (TREE_OPERAND (*expr_p, 0));
194 	if (INTEGRAL_TYPE_P (type) && c_promoting_integer_type_p (type))
195 	  {
196 	    if (TYPE_OVERFLOW_UNDEFINED (type))
197 	      type = unsigned_type_for (type);
198 	    return gimplify_self_mod_expr (expr_p, pre_p, post_p, 1, type);
199 	  }
200 	break;
201       }
202 
203     default:;
204     }
205 
206   return GS_UNHANDLED;
207 }
